For what it's worth, the TRD rear sway bar fits well and works well. I installed one on my 2008 Yaris when I first bought the car. I've put 130,000 miles on the car since then, and I have had no problems with the TRD bar rubbing or clunking. But it made the handling much more balanced. So, if you don't find a cheaper one, don't feel bad about spending the money on a TRD sway bar.
